Twilight's eyes widened at the revelation. "The Shadowbolts! Weren't you a member of the Wonderbolts!"
Rainbow Dash lifted a hoof and put it behind her head sheepishly. "Uh, yeah, I was. But about a year ago, the princess went to one of our shows. After the show, she was really impressed with my flying, she practically begged me to join! So about a month ago, I took her up on it."
The uniformed mare chuckled. "The first day, I showed them how to actually fly. I mean, I flew circles and squares and all sorts of shapes around them." She smirked. "So they just decided to make me captain and be done with it!"
Pinkie Pie hugged her friend, showing unusual restraint as she didn't disturb the clothing at all. "Congratulations, Rainbow Dash! We should throw a party! Yeah!" With that, Pinkie Pie disappeared from the entry hall, to the kitchen if the sounds emitting from that room were any indicator. Spike left as well, presumably to help.
"Uh, yeah, ok?" Rainbow Dash said to the now-vanished Pinkie. "So what's been going on with you girls?"
Rarity was quick to speak up. "Well, Twilight has her eyes on a certain stallion."
Twilight immediately grabbed the nearest book with her magic and chucked it at the fashionista. "Rarity!"
"What? It's true!" The white unicorn nimbly dodged the book.
"I would like to know more about him, Twilight," Fluttershy's soft voice called out.
"Yeah, me too!" Rainbow was hovering near Rarity.
"Fine then!" Twilight shouted. She took a deep breath to calm herself, then said to Rainbow Dash and Fluttershy, "His name is Rising Dusk and we work together. Happy?"
"The egghead? You like an egghead?" Rainbow Dash said incredulously. "Well, I guess that makes sense, you are an egghead after all." Twilight frowned at her blue friend.
"You know Dusk?" The purple unicorn asked.
"Of course. He's one of Luna's advisors. So am I, for that matter." She paused, looking at the expressions on Twilight's and Rarity's faces. "Yup, I'm her flight advisor. Dusk is like her magic advisor or something. I kind of forget. Didn't seem very interesting."
Rarity rolled her eyes at the comments. "Of course you would say that, Dashie darling. You find nearly anything not related to flying boring."
"It's not my fault if he doesn't do anything cool. All I ever see him do is stargazing," Rainbow shot back. "That's right, stargazing. Not any cool magic stuff. Ever."
"Magic is a lot more than just flashiness," Twilight said to her rainbow-maned friend. "Magic is a lot of effort as well. You can't just think of something and it happens."
"Anyways, back to the subject at hand, Twilight has her eyes on a stallion. I think that answers one question-" Rarity began before cut off by Twilight.
"Rarity! You know that-" Twilight stuttered.
"Please Twilight, I was just joking." Rarity tossed her mane out of her eyes. "And with how you've been acting around the stallions of Equestria..." Rarity trailed off after receiving a glare from Twilight.
Both of them turned towards Fluttershy, who had coughed slightly to garner their attention. "Why do you like him? I mean, if you don't me prying..." the pale yellow pegasus asked, her voice clearly nervous.
Twilight pondered the question for several seconds before answering. "I guess," Twilight began, "it's because he doesn't see me as Celestia's student like everypony else does. He doesn't see me as someone who's a bookworm or a pony who's too bossy. He sees me as, well, me."
"Now isn't that romantic," Rarity said. "Not to mention that he's absolutely gorgeous. And he walks like he's royalty!"
"Jeez, Rarity, you almost sound like you're with him," Rainbow Dash commented.
"What? Oh no, I have my eyes on someone else!"
"Oh really?" Rainbow had crossed the distance between the two of them in less than a second.
"Spill!" she practically shouted.
Whatever Rarity would have said would never be known, for at that moment, the pink mare known as Pinkie Pie exploded out of the kitchen. Before her was her infamous party cannon. "Party!" she called out.
Twilight and Rarity knew enough from living with her to duck; Fluttershy and Rainbow Dash didn't. The confetti that shot from the cannon passed over both of the unicorns and covered the pegasi. Both of the covered ponies had looks of utter shock from the confetti.
Surprisingly, Fluttershy recovered first from her sitting position. She looked at the two of them, then towards the three clean mares.
"Yay," she said.
The party had gone well, albeit with a few minor mishaps. The biggest one being that Rainbow didn't know that the lemonade had been spiked. Twilight visibly grimaced at the pun. After ensuring that the half-drunk pegasus made it to her room, left her apartment for a walk amongst the now present lunar sky.
She walked through the palace gardens for several hours, finally stopping and sitting in front of the statue of the imprisoned Discord. His arms were still outstretched, as if trying to shield himself.
"Twilight?" a voice called out. Twilight turned to look at the voice. She saw Luna's advisor walking towards her.
"Hmm? Oh, Dusk!" Twilight could feel the blood rushing to her face. "What are you doing out here?"
"I walk out here a lot; it helps clear my mind." He stopped and sat next to her, joining her gaze towards the statue. "Remembering the past?" he asked.
"Yes and no," Twilight replied.
The unicorn stallion raised an eyebrow at this.
"Well, I've been thinking about a lot of things lately. My friends, my job, the future in general really. I mean, here I am, working at the castle, but I don't really know what I want to do. I don't see myself working here in five years, you know? I just don't see me doing this. My job and my friends all make me happy, but I don't know what I want. My friends all are moving on, doing things. Meanwhile, I've been here for the past five years."
"So you want to know what you'll be doing in five years or so?" Dusk replied. "What if you don't like what you see?"
"Then I'd try to change it. The future isn't set in stone."
Dusk looked at her, his face clouded. He gave a small smile. "Always trying to change the world. Well then, we should probably head back towards our rooms." He rose and gestured for Twilight to do the same. The two walked side by side, until they reached the tower where Twilight lived.
"You know," Dusk said. "You never did answer my question."
"What..." Twilight managed to stutter.
"If you would go to the Summer Sun Celebration with me," he said, staring into her eyes.
Twilight blushed and looked away. "I, uh..."
"Do you?" he asked again.
"Yes," Twilight whispered after a moment. "Yes, I would like to go to the festival with you."
She looked up and realized how close they were.
